The popularity of watching anime has surged dramatically over the past decade, reflecting its growing global appeal and the transformative impact of digital media. Multiple factors have fueled this surge in popularity, establishing anime as a cherished entertainment form for millions globally.

Growing International Audience One of the primary reasons for anime’s rising popularity is its growing international audience. Once confined largely to Japan, anime has found a massive international audience thanks to the proliferation of streaming platforms like Crunchyroll, Funimation, Netflix, and Hulu. These platforms have allowed global access to anime, providing a wide selection of series and films with subtitles and dubs in different languages. This broader accessibility has brought anime to new viewers who might not have come across it otherwise.

Varied and Creative Storytelling Anime’s appeal is also fueled by its diverse and innovative content. The medium encompasses a wide range of genres, from action and adventure to romance, science fiction, and slice-of-life. This variety ensures that there is something for everyone, regardless of age or taste. Anime is renowned for its inventive storytelling and unique worlds, often tackling intricate themes and well-developed characters. Shows such as “Attack on Titan,” “My Hero Academia,” and “Spirited Away” exemplify how anime captivates viewers with distinct stories and top-notch production.

Fan Engagement and Online Communities The vibrant online anime community also contributes greatly to its popularity. Platforms like social media, forums, and fan sites offer spaces for discussions, fan art, and cosplay, building a strong community among anime fans. This active fan engagement helps to promote anime and generate excitement for new releases, creating a dynamic environment that drives continued interest and growth.

Cultural Influence Anime’s influence extends beyond entertainment, impacting fashion, music, and language. Its cultural footprint has contributed to its widespread popularity, with anime characters and themes becoming ingrained in global pop culture.

The popularity of watching anime is driven by its global reach, diverse content, binge-watching culture, active fan community, and cultural impact.
